Spider Control Service in New Braunfels, TX
Spider control services focus on identifying and removing spiders that may pose a nuisance or concern for homeowners. These services typically cover residential properties, including indoor spaces, yards, and surrounding structures where spiders tend to build webs or seek shelter. Common projects involve inspecting for spider activity, removing webs, and applying targeted treatments to reduce spider populations and prevent future infestations. Property owners often seek these services to create a safer, more comfortable living environment and to address concerns about potential bites or the presence of spiders in frequently used areas.
Before requesting spider control,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the treatment, including which areas will be treated and the types of products used. It’s also helpful to know whether the service includes follow-up visits or ongoing prevention measures. Clarifying any safety considerations, such as the presence of children or pets, can ensure that treatments are appropriate for the specific property. Having a clear understanding of the process and expected outcomes can assist homeowners in making informed decisions about managing spider activity on their property.

Spider Control Service Questions
What are common signs of spider infestations? Webs in corners, sightings of spiders, and egg sacs are typical indicators of a spider problem.
How do spiders typically enter homes? Spiders often enter through gaps around windows, doors, vents, and other small openings.
Are there specific areas where spiders tend to gather? They commonly gather in dark, undisturbed places like basements, attics, and behind furniture.
What steps are involved in spider control services? The process usually includes inspection, removal of webs and spiders, and sealing entry points to prevent future invasions.
